The Sultan of Johor is a hereditary seat and the nominal ruler of the Malaysian state of Johor. In the past, the sultan held absolute power over the state and was advised by a Bendahara. Nowadays, the role of Bendahara has been taken over by a more powerful Menteri Besar, with the Sultan's office being reduced to a titular head function.
2. History: The first Sultan of Johor was Alauddin Riayat Shah II, the son of the last Sultan of Melaka, Sultan Mahmud Shah. The scion of the Sultanate of Melaka in Johor ended with the death of Sultan Mahmud Shah II in 1699 and the throne was taken over by Sultan Abdul Jalil IV, his Bendahara. Though Johor has been ruled by over 20 Sultans, the first Sultan of Modern Johor (Temenggong Dynasty)[1] was Sultan Abu Bakar who reigned from 1862 to 1895. He was the first person from the Temenggung family to become the Sultan in Johor's history. His father, Raja Temenggong Daeng Ibrahim, managed to consolidate enough power to disfranchise Sultan Ali who died in 1877.
